如何在可视化建站中实现多用户权限管理?

在当今信息化时代,网站已经成为企业、组织和个人展示自身形象、拓展业务的重要平台。然而,随着网站功能的日益丰富,如何实现多用户权限管理成为了一个亟待解决的问题。本文将深入探讨如何在可视化建站中实现多用户权限管理,以帮助您更好地管理网站资源。

一、可视化建站与多用户权限管理

  1. 可视化建站

可视化建站是指通过图形化界面,让用户无需编写代码即可搭建网站。这种建站方式具有操作简单、易上手、功能丰富等特点,深受广大用户喜爱。


  1. 多用户权限管理

多用户权限管理是指对网站中的不同用户分配不同的权限,以实现资源的合理分配和有效控制。在可视化建站中,多用户权限管理尤为重要,它可以帮助企业或组织保护核心资源,防止非法访问。

二、可视化建站中实现多用户权限管理的策略

  1. 用户角色划分

在可视化建站中,首先需要对用户进行角色划分。常见的角色包括:管理员、编辑、普通用户等。根据不同的角色,分配相应的权限。


  1. 权限分配

在角色划分的基础上,对每个角色进行权限分配。例如,管理员拥有最高权限,可以管理网站的所有资源;编辑拥有编辑内容的权限;普通用户只能浏览网站内容。


  1. 权限控制

为实现权限控制,可视化建站平台应具备以下功能:

(1)访问控制:限制用户对特定资源的访问权限,如文件、数据库等。

(2)操作控制:限制用户对特定操作的操作权限,如修改、删除、发布等。

(3)审计日志:记录用户操作日志,便于追踪和审计。


  1. 权限继承

在可视化建站中,部分权限可以继承。例如,管理员角色下的所有权限都自动赋予编辑角色。这样可以简化权限管理,提高效率。


  1. 权限变更

为适应业务需求,权限可能需要变更。可视化建站平台应提供权限变更功能,方便管理员根据实际情况调整权限。

三、案例分析

某企业采用可视化建站平台搭建企业官网,通过以下步骤实现多用户权限管理:

  1. 角色划分:管理员、编辑、普通用户。

  2. 权限分配:管理员拥有最高权限,编辑拥有编辑内容的权限,普通用户只能浏览网站内容。

  3. 权限控制:限制编辑对特定文件的修改权限,防止重要文件泄露。

  4. 权限继承:管理员角色下的所有权限自动赋予编辑角色。

  5. 权限变更:根据业务需求,管理员可随时调整编辑和普通用户的权限。

通过以上措施,该企业成功实现了可视化建站中的多用户权限管理,保障了网站资源的安全。

四、总结

在可视化建站中实现多用户权限管理,有助于保护网站资源,提高工作效率。企业或组织应根据自身需求,合理划分角色、分配权限,并采用有效的权限控制策略。通过不断优化和调整,确保网站安全、稳定运行。

猜你喜欢:OpenTelemetry